- [ ] Step 7: Archive cold storage buckets (Glacierline tier). Confirm both ceremony witnesses are present, verify bucket manifests match the Oxbow ledger, then seal the archive key shares. Plugin authors may observe but not handle shares. Once sealed, the archive index itself is encrypted and can only be reopened with the passphrase below.

vault phrase of badup-hahig = tamael-aldael-kelmir-istael-fenok-istwyn-tamius-jorath-oliion

Q3 Planning Note — New Subscription Tier

Quick one for branch managers: we're launching the "Meridian Plus" tier in September, slotting between Standard and Premier. Early pilots in the Ashfold region showed solid uptake, mostly upgrades rather than cannibalization. Train your counter staff on the pitch before launch week. Pricing sheets land Monday. The bigger picture is spelled out below.

board note of tadup-tajog: Headcount on the Oliiel team goes from 31 to 88 by the end of February. Gross margin on Oliiel came in at 62 percent against a plan of 29 percent.

Subject: Insurance renewal — quick read before we sign

Hi all — the Greymoor Mutual renewal quote for Tallowfield Goods landed yesterday. Premiums are up 12%, mostly from the warehouse fire exposure at the Dunbrook site. Broker thinks we can shave a few points by bundling the fleet cover, and I'm inclined to agree. We need department sign-offs by Thursday or we default to the old terms, which are worse. Flag any coverage gaps you've noticed this year. One sensitive point needs to stay within this group.

board note of fahap-yafop: Headcount on the Istion team goes from 50 to 73 by the end of September. Gross margin on Istion came in at 33 percent against a plan of 28 percent.